触摸屏LED彩色台灯的设计

发布者:NexusDream最新更新时间:2016-10-09 来源: elecfans关键字:触摸屏  LED  彩色台灯 手机看文章 扫描二维码
随时随地手机看文章
  一、总体设计

  系统的总体框图如图1 所示。系统可有输入,输出,控制三部分组成,当触摸屏被按下触摸屏芯片读取触摸屏上X 轴与Y 轴的值,然后通过SPI 协议传送到控制器,控制器负责信号的处理,把处理完毕的信号以PWM 方式输出驱动LED.

图1 系统总体框图

  图1 系统总体框图

  二、触摸屏的使用

  本系统选择电阻式触摸屏,它将矩形区域中触摸点(X,Y) 的物理位置转换为代表X 坐标和Y 坐标的电压其触摸屏结构如图2 所示。图3 显示了四线触摸屏在两层相接触时的简化模型。对于四线触摸屏,最理想的连接方法是将偏置为VREF 的总线接ADC 的正参考输入端,并将设置为0V 的总线接ADC 的负参考输入端。

图2 电阻触摸屏结构。

  图2 电阻触摸屏结构。

图3 电阻触摸屏简化模型

  图3 电阻触摸屏简化模型

  三、接口电路设计

  1. 控制器与触摸屏连接

  本系统采用美国TI 公司生产的ADS7843,该芯片内置12 位AD 转换、低导通电阻模拟开关的SPI 总线接口触摸屏控制。供电电压为2.7 ~ 5.25V,参考电压VREF 为1V~+VCC,转换电压范围为0 ~ VREF,控制器可通过内置的SPI 输出口MOSI、MISO、SCK 与触摸屏芯片进行连接,如图4 所示。

图4 单片机与触摸屏接口电路图。

  图4 单片机与触摸屏接口电路图

  2. LED驱动电路

 

  控制器输出PWM 波形作为驱动电路的驱动信号,三极管Q1 作为斩波器件。当驱动信号为高电平时三极管处于截止状态,LED 不亮;当输入信号为低电平三极管处于导通状态,LED 点亮。红色LED 的驱动电路如图5 所示,绿色与蓝色LED 的驱动电路的结构与红色的相同,单片机的PB7 端为绿色LED 的驱动信号,PD4 为蓝色LED 的驱动信号。

  图5 红色LED的驱动电路图

  四、系统的程序设计

  1.系统总流程图

  系统硬件可以分为输入、控制、输出部分,其中控制部分是连接输入、输出。单片机程序决定输入如何影响输出,输出如何响应输入,其具体框图如图6 所示。单片机对ADS7843 进行读取后对数据进行坐标变换,最后把处理的值输出驱动LED.

图6 系统软件流程图

  图6 系统软件流程图。

  2.触摸屏坐标读取

  所谓的触摸点坐标是指当触摸屏被按下时触摸芯片读出的X 轴与Y 轴的数值。触摸坐标的读取时非常关键的,它是触摸屏使用过程中最重要的环节,若触摸点坐标有误,将导致单片机错误处理。首先使能ADS7843,然后向ADS7843 写入测量X 坐标的控制字,延时若干毫秒后,读取ADS7843 的转换数据。读取的数据即X 的坐标值;再把测量Y 坐标控制字写入ADS7843,延时若干毫秒后,读取ADS7843 的转换数据,就得到了Y 坐标的值,然后禁止ADS7843.这样既完成了一次读取坐标值的过程。其具体流程如图7所示。

图7 ADS7843读取框图

  图7 ADS7843读取框图

  3.系统坐标校准处理

 

  由于任意两个触摸屏上的点密度都不可能完全一致,所以要求在使用触摸屏之前,必须进行校准。校准方式有两点校准,三点校准,四点校准等。其中,校准的点数越多,触摸屏数据越精确,校准也越繁琐。本系统使用两点校准的方法对触摸屏进行校准。

  (1) 先分别测试触摸屏左下角及右上角的坐标(ads7843_xmin,ads7843_ymin);(ads7843_xmax,ads7843_ymax);

  (2) 计算水平方向的比率(ads7843_xts)和垂直方向的比率(ads7843_yts);

  (3)假设液晶屏中的当前点是液晶屏坐标(X,Y):

  当前点的触摸屏的X 坐标=X× ads7843_xts+ ads7843_xmin ;

  当前点的触摸屏的Y 坐标=Y× ads7843_yts+ ads7843_ymin ;

  系统执行校准程序后把触摸屏左下角, 右下角的坐标值与水平方向的比率存放如单片机EEPROM 中,每当系统重新启动时调用对应的数值有于对触摸位置的判别。

  4.控制器SPI通讯

  控制器ATmega48内部集成SPI通讯所需的软硬件功能,主机和从机之间的SPI 连接如图8所示。系统包括两个移位寄存器和一个主机时钟发生器,通过将从机的 SS引脚拉低,主机启动一次通讯过程。主机和从机将需要发送的数据放入相应的移位寄存器。主机在SCK引脚上产生时钟脉冲以交换数据。主机的数据从主机的MOSI移出,从从机的MOSI移入;从机的数据从从机的MISO移出,从主机的MISO移入。主机通过将从机的SS拉高实现与从机的同步。

图8 控制器SPI通讯框图

  图8 控制器SPI通讯框图

  A D S 7 8 4 3 读写时序如图9 所示。由此可见ADS7843 SPI接口的一次完整操作需要3×8=24个DCLK时钟周期,前8个脉冲接收8位的命令,并在第6个脉冲的上升沿开始A/D转换器进入采样阶段,从第9个脉冲开始进入转换阶段,输出12位采样值,转换结束进入空闲阶段。直到24个DCLK结束,CS置高电平,一次测量结束。

图9 单端模式的数据读写

  图9 单端模式的数据读写

  5.控制器PWM输出

  系统使用了控制器快速PWM 模式对驱动控制,当系统采用8MHz 晶振频率是快速PWM 模式频率最大值为31.25KHz.计数器从BOTTOM计到MAX,然后立即回到BOTTOM 重新开始。

  对于普通的比较输出模式,输出比较引脚OCRn在TCNTn 与OCRn 匹配时清零, 在BOTTOM时置位;对于反向比较输出模式,OCRn 的动作正好相反。具体的时序图如图10 所示。图中柱状的TCNTn 表示这是单边斜坡操作。方框图同时包含了普通的PWM 输出以及方向PWM 输出。

  TCNTn 斜坡上的短水平线表示OCRn 和TCNTn的比较匹配。产生PWM 波形的机理是OCRn 寄存器在OCRnX 与TCNTn 匹配时置位( 或清零),以及在计数器清零( 从TOP 变为BOTTOM)的那一个定时器时钟周期清零( 或置位)。输出的PWM 频率可以通过如下公式计算得到:

  变量N 代表分频因子(1、8、64、256 或1024)。

图10 快速PWM时序图

  图10 快速PWM时序图

  五、结论

  LED 在控制电路及控制方式的简易与颜色的多样性使其在多彩照明方面具有极大的发展,多彩LED 只要配以简单的控制方可发出不同的颜色,颜色控制设备的多样性可供用户选择。无论如何LED 的上述特点都是其成为多彩照明中的光源首选,使用LED能为我们未来的生活带来缤纷的色彩。多彩LED 照明系统是一个极具开发前景的课题,随着国家对大功率LED 的进一步推广LED 的造价会继续下降,LED 灯具的普及将会很快到来。

关键字:触摸屏  LED  彩色台灯 引用地址:触摸屏LED彩色台灯的设计

上一篇:AVR 基本硬件线路与分析
下一篇:AVR 相位修正PWM模式应用

推荐阅读最新更新时间:2024-03-16 15:14

三星在电影院首装LED屏幕
据外媒报道, 三星 宣布了电影行业中的一个大事件:它首次在电影院安装了 LED 屏幕。 早在今年3月,这个韩国电子巨头就首次公布了LED电影屏幕的消息,并在拉斯维加斯奥尔良酒店和赌场的一系列活动中首次展示了这种电影屏幕。这种10.3米长的电影屏幕已安装到了韩国乐天电影世界大厦。 数年来,电影院一直在尝试向数字 投影仪 转变。 4K电影 也成了当下的热门话题。而利用高动态范围(HDR)的屏幕也是稀罕物,它可以提高视频中的色度对比,让白色变得更白,黑色变得更黑。 三星的LED电影屏幕不仅支持4k(4096*2160)分辨率,而且还支持HDR图像。但是,这种屏幕要比通常的电影屏幕小很多,因为通常的电影屏幕长13.5米到21.6米。  
[嵌入式]
从不受待见到受追捧:LED透明屏还有很长路要走
  9月20日,第十三届上海国际 LED 展在上海浦东新国际博览中心正式拉开帷幕,同期展会包括2017上海国际数字标牌展和第十五届上海国际广告展,主要展示了 LED 显示屏产业链应用,其中户外应用成为主要方向。据OFweek显示网编辑现场观察,小间距和透明 LED 显示屏正成为行业重点关注方向,今天先给大家带来透明LED显示屏相关产品及市场分析。下面就随手机便携小编一起来了解一下相关内容吧。      由于LED透明屏具有通透、轻薄、易于安装、节能环保等特点,广泛应用于展览展示、玻璃幕墙设计、空间设计、橱窗设计等领域,在城市地标建筑、市政建筑、高档商场、汽车4S店、展览馆、品牌连锁店、机场等场所具有很好的应用前景。
[手机便携]
从不受待见到受追捧:<font color='red'>LED</font>透明屏还有很长路要走
在城市夜景照明中应用LED的思考
   LED照明 在我国迅猛发展,已越来越广泛地应用到城市照明领域,如交 通信 号、应急照明、广告标识、商业步行街、建(构)筑物、城市广场、园林景观等,照明应用范围不断扩大。LED作为一种由 半导体 技术制作的电光源被称为21世纪新一代光源,因其具有节能、长寿命和环保等优势,人们普遍预测它将替代传统光源。通过863、攻关等一系列科技计划的支持,我国已初步形成了一定程度的LED产业链。改革开放使我国经济飞速发展,中国已成为世界第一大光源、灯具生产和使用国之一。随着国家对LED发展的高度重视和我国LED产业快速发展,中国有望成为世界LED生产主要基地和LED照明应用最大国家之一。目前,LED在我国城市夜景照明领域已开始普及,几乎全国所
[电源管理]
智能制造政策加速落地,将加大在原材料等领域应用
互联网带动传统产业所爆发出的能量,正帮企业带来指数级的价值突破,把它总结为一个公式就是:互联网×传统产业=重资产的轻工业化。 1、威马汽车温州工厂生产线已全面贯通 近日,威马汽车对外公布称,其位于浙江温州的威马新能源汽车 智能产业园生产线已全面贯通,首款量产车EX5将于本月28日下线,并确定于下半年全面交付。公开资料显示,威马汽车位于温州的智能产业园占地1000亩,具备智能制造、智慧物流、零部件柔性化配套、自动驾驶试验四大功能,前期产能是为10万辆/年,最大可增产至20万辆/年。 2、海源公司打造世界级新能源汽车轻量化生产线 年产碳纤维车身5万套!海源公司打造世界级新能源汽车轻量化生产线。目前该项目在意大利米兰
[网络通信]
分析大功率LED灯的驱动方法及其应用技术
近年来,由于 半导体 光 电子 技术的进步,又一代新光源----LED的发光效率迅速提高,预示着一个新光源时代的到来。就LED的技术潜力和发展趋势来看,其发光效率将达到200lm/w以上,超过当前光效最高的高强度气体放电灯,成为世界上最亮的光源。因此,业界认为,半导体照明将创造照明产业的第四次革命。 半导体照明最大量的应用将是普通照明领域。半导体灯用于普通照明一般要有比较大的功率。虽然就目前的技术状态来看,商品化发光 二极管 的成本和光效还不太适合用于大功率的普通照明,但由于发光二极管有安全,长寿命,颜色种类多,不怕闪烁,调控方便等优点,在某些场合应用能够形成综合成本优势,实际上已经开始在大功率照明方面获得应用。
[电源管理]
大屏iPad继续曝光:触摸屏配新材料有玄机
    据韩国《电子时报》报道称,苹果正在考虑为12.9寸的iPad Pro配备一种新型触摸屏,使用银纳米线(AgNW)材料,而不是传统的氧化铟锡透明导电薄膜。   新材料可以大大提升触摸屏的精准度和灵敏度,并且可以识别多种压力级别,从而支持Focre Touch。   由于不需要使用铟这样的稀有金属,新材料的成本会更低。   苹果已经要求LG Display、Samsung Display、Japan Display等面板厂商从本周起提供相关样品,并做好量产准备。   另外,苹果还考虑为触摸屏加上一层蓝宝石晶体薄膜,以增加其强度,但供应商能不能生产出这么大尺寸的还是个问题。   该报道还称,iPad Pro得等到2
[手机便携]
博世推出专为智能家居虚拟触摸屏BML100PI模块
在中国上海举行的慕尼黑上海电子展上,Bosch Sensortec展示了BML100PI,这是一款能够为智能家居各类表面增加虚拟触摸屏的互动投影模块,可将普通储物架变为个人助理。 BML100PI模块为交互式投影提供了一套完整的即用型解决方案,可实现高度灵活的虚拟触摸屏。所生成的激光束可在任何表面上创建无需聚焦图像,然后逐行扫描以检测任何手势或手指移动。准确的手势和触摸识别无需校准或调整。Bosch Sensortec的交互式投影模块为所有智能家居设备增添触摸屏,并可实现高度直观的用户体验,与静态物理屏幕相比,可谓是一种完全灵活的替代产品。 智能家居的私人助理 家用设备制造商可以使用BML100PI来创建“智能储物架”,包
[嵌入式]
博世推出专为智能家居虚拟<font color='red'>触摸屏</font>BML100PI模块
可调LED亮度的DC-DC转换器TPS61042
摘要:TPS61042是美国德州仪器公司生产的DC-DC转换器。该器件同时可作为LED的驱动器,且其驱动输出电压可达27.5V。文中介绍了TPS61042的工作原理及典型应用设计方法。 关键词:DC-DC转换器;脉冲频率调制PFM;脉冲宽度调制PWM;TPS61042 1 特点 TPS61042是一种高频控制直流输出的LED驱动器。通过将其脉冲宽度调制(PWM)信号加至控制端(CTRL)可以调节LED亮度。LED电流可以通过外部检测电阻设置。由于TPS61042内置N沟道 500mA MOSFET,因而可有效地限制尖峰脉冲,其转换频率高达1MHz。另外,芯片的CTRL脚控制信号还可以在停机状态下使LED与地断开,从而可有效
[应用]
小广播
添点儿料...
无论热点新闻、行业分析、技术干货……
设计资源 培训 开发板 精华推荐

最新单片机文章
何立民专栏 单片机及嵌入式宝典

北京航空航天大学教授,20余年来致力于单片机与嵌入式系统推广工作。

换一换 更多 相关热搜器件
电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ved